On Feb. 22nd 2013 I prchased from Apple Store, The Galleria in Fort Lauderdale, FL an IPhone 5,white, 32 GB Verizon company, model MD659LL, A1429 CDMA.

The IPhone was purchased at the amount of 793.94$ (Full Price - No contrac).

To my regret the IPhone cannot be connected to wifi or connected very weak for 1 min. (Poor wifi singal).
In addition, there is a leak of light under the lock bottom:

avoid-scuffgate-and-other-iphone-5-problems.w654.jpg


Next week I return to the States after a period in Israel, and I have a few questions:
1.Can I go to any branch of Apple?
2.Will I get a new device out of the box or refurb one? I do not want the problem with the wifi will be in the new device will also :/
If I get refurb one its look like new or used?
3.I could ask a black device?32 GB CDMA A1429 like my model?

Thank you

1.1.Can I go to any branch of Apple?

A: I would recommend you just go to a official apple store.

2. 2.Will I get a new device out of the box or refurb one? I do not want the problem with the wifi will be in the new device will also :/

A: You are 99% of the time going to get a refurbished model.

3. If I get refurb one its look like new or used?

A: It will not look used at all, I've gotten 2 replacement iPhone 5's and both looked new

4. I could ask a black device?32 GB CDMA A1429 like my model?

A: No, they will swap out a white 32GB for a white 32GB nothing else.

They will give you an entire new phone, on the spot and take your old one. It's a refurbed phone but it has passed all the quality that a new one has to pass.
 
The refurbs are brand new on the outside. When apple takes a old phone, the only parts they keep are some of the internals in the phone. The shell is brand new

The replacement process is quite simple.

Make a Genius Bar appointment here, bring your phone in along with the original receipt and it'll be taken care of, no worries. No need to record a conversation with an Apple rep, haha. Best of luck!
 
I have never had to show the original receipt. They will check the serial number for warranty which it is in. And they will replace it this way.
 
And if I go without setting meeting they may not accept me?
I just come to New York and then fly to Boston.

It is definitely a good idea to set an appointment. The stores are often very busy, and many times there will be no appointments available if you go to the store without one.
 
Thank you! I also get new headphones and charger? Should bring the purchase receipt or record a telephone conversation with a representative? Should make an appointment with a representative or simply get?

You will not get new headphones or charger unless they are defective.

I highly recommend making a Genius Bar appointment. You could wait an hour or more if you do not have an appointment.
